Do Minecraft worlds transfer between iphones?

If you are playing Minecraft: Bedrock Edition, the easiest way to transfer that world to another device is to use Realms. You can use a Realms or Realms Plus subscription to do this. If you have not subscribed before, you can also use a free 30-day trial to move your world quickly.

How to recover Minecraft worlds on iPhone?

How to Recover Missing Minecraft Worlds on Apple Devices
  1. Make sure your app is up to date by going to the App store and selecting Update.
  2. Launch the Minecraft app on your Apple device.
  3. Open the Minecraft Marketplace.
  4. Select the Store.
  5. Scroll down to purchases and select Restore Purchases.

How to save Minecraft worlds on phone?

mojang>minecraftWorlds-folder. Each folder on this location contains one Minecraft World. The advantage of Android, over iOS, is the possibility to create a backup of a single world. Just copy the wanted world-folder to another location (e.g. SD-card) or zip the folder and upload it to Google Drive.

How to save Minecraft world to iCloud?

Press and hold to open the menu. Tap Save to Files. Locate your iCloud drive and save the world file to the iCloud Drive folders where you want to store it. Click Save.

Do Minecraft worlds back up?

If your Minecraft world isn't associated with a Realms subscription, your worlds are not backed up automatically. It is a good idea to periodically backup or save a copy of your Minecraft files.

How to import a Minecraft world on iPhone?

Tap the world file, tap open in another app and select Minecraft. Minecraft will open, the world will import and it should say it successfully imported. You can tap “play” to find and join the world from your world list.

How to recover deleted Minecraft worlds on mobile?

If you've backed up your phone, here's how to recover deleted Minecraft worlds on mobile devices running Android:
  1. Go to Settings > Accounts and backup.
  2. Tap Restore data.
  3. Choose the desired backup if there's more than one.
  4. Select Apps, ensure they include Minecraft, and tap Restore.

How do you save a Minecraft world after deleting the app?

Type "%appdata%" then press OK. Go into your . minecraft folder, then your saves folder, then (if you remember the name of your deleted world) copypaste the world folder into the same saves folder. Go back into Minecraft and play your recovered Minecraft world.
